ABOUT US

Hendriks Greenhouses is a family-owned grower of high-quality floral and tropical plants. We value teamwork, problem-solving, and keeping our operations running at their best.

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Maintenance experience in a greenhouse, agricultural, or similar environment preferred
  • Post-secondary education in Mechanical, Electrical, Facility Maintenance, or related field is an asset
  • Valid Ontario G driver’s license required
  • Skilled in using hand and power tools for maintenance and repairs
  • Knowledge of greenhouse equipment, machinery, and maintenance best practices
  • Effective communication skills and a collaborative mindset
  • Ability to perform moderate to heavy physical work, including lifting, bending, standing, and working at heights when necessary
Responsibilities

THE ROLE

As a Maintenance Associate, you’ll keep our greenhouse facilities running smoothly, ensuring equipment, systems, and the work environment support healthy plant growth. This hands-on role is ideal for someone who enjoys using tools, solving problems, and thriving in a fast-paced, team-oriented setting. We’re looking for someone capable of managing daily maintenance, ideally with greenhouse, plumbing, electrical, or mechanical experience.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Oversee daily maintenance activities to ensure smooth greenhouse and facility operations
  • Perform preventative maintenance on HVAC, electrical, mechanical, irrigation, and other systems
  • Troubleshoot and repair minor plumbing, electrical, structural, and equipment issues
  • Coordinate with the Greenhouse Operations Manager and contractors for repairs or installations
  • Maintain greenhouse grounds, walkways, and surrounding facilities
  • Assist with assembly, relocation, and installation of equipment and machinery
  • Ensure compliance with WHMIS, OHSA, and company safety policies
  • Participate in Health & Safety, Fire Safety, and Emergency Management programs
